West Brom and Poland fans were impressed with a match-winning display from winger Kamil Grosicki as Poland came from behind to beat Bosnia and Herzegovina on Monday night.
Poland went a goal down in their UEFA Nations League match, but an inspired performance from Grosicki turned the game around as he scored and provided an assist for his country, with Poland eventually winning 2-1.
Grosicki made the most of his start after only making a substitute appearance against the Netherlands in Poland’s last outing.
The winger took the corner that found the head of centre-back Kamil Glik on the stroke of half time, which brought Poland level, before heading in a cross himself in the 67th minute.
Grosicki’s goal handed Poland the win and sent them to third in their Nations League group, only one point off group leaders Italy.
The main priority for Baggies fans will be that Grosicki has made it through his international duties without picking up an injury, meaning he can participate in West Brom’s opening Premier League fixture against Leicester City.
The Baggies will be looking for Grosicki to provide valuable top-flight experience and he will be looking to add to his 15 appearances and four assists for Hull City in the Premier League.
